Check out our Ketchikan Airport Terminal Expansion project!

The terminal expansion continues to take shape! ✈️

Recent progress includes exterior brickwork, new window installation, roofing certification, and major interior mechanical and electrical work.

As crews prepare to connect the new structure to the existing terminal, planning remains focused on safety, resilience, and minimizing impacts to travelers.

Since 1915, this long riveted steel pipe has carried water down the mountain to help power Juneau. It was built 44 years before Alaska was even a state, and it's still doing its job today!

Over the next 4 years, we'll be working with Alaska Electric Light & Power to replace 4,300 feet of pipe at Salmon Creek Dam, helping ensure this system continues delivering reliable hydropower to the community.

While this project wouldn't normally take 4 years to complete, Juneau needs this water flowing from July through March. That gives Dawson Superintendent Mike Vanderjack and his crew just a three-month window each year to work on each section — a challenge they're proud to take on as they safely deliver this multi-phase project for the Juneau community.

Standing at the harbor that bears her husband's name, Anita Statter cut the ribbon on the latest phase of improvements at Statter Harbor.

After the ribbon was cut, Don Statter's family walked the new baywalk together as Auke Bay Elementary students sang the Alaska Flag Song.

The project adds a contiguous baywalk along the waterfront, along with pedestrian and bicycle access, lighting, landscaping and outdoor seating — creating new ways for residents and visitors to experience the harbor.

Don D. Statter dedicated much of his career to Alaska's waterfronts and public infrastructure. Watching his family celebrate another chapter at the harbor named in his honor was a reminder that great projects can continue serving communities long after they're built.

We're proud to have partnered with City and Borough of Juneau on a project that will serve the Juneau community for years to come.
